Jessica Altman of CoveredCA hosted Rep. Rep. Doris Matsui to discuss the impact on #Sacramento if the #ACA's enhanced premium tax credits expire at the end of the year. Premiums would rise by 97% on average and 111% in Rep. Matsui's district.

“In #Sacramento County, Altman said as an example, a family of four earning $113,000 a year could see its monthly premium jump by about $1,550 if the government subsidies expire, compared to just $112 if subsidies remain.” #TrumpTax @coveredca.bsky.social

Covered California has released its dental rates for plan year 2026 with a weighted average rate change of just 0.35%. This continues a multi-year trend of steady costs for consumers receiving #dental care with their #ACA #healthcare plans in #California. Bit.ly/3JwmFDz
Covered California Announces Premium Change for 2026 Dental Plans After Another Year of Steady Growth
Covered California announced that the statewide weighted average rate change for dental plans offered through the marketplace in 2026 will be 0.35 percent.
